You really shouldn't be assuming anything Ofer. My experiences with attempting to solve this problem have been extensive. And my discussions with various different people over the years about it have been well documented on this forum. Jet sizes and angles, wand shields and side notches have all been attempted. Nothing has solved it.

And those of you who say you don't have the problem with your wands are mistaken. You are just not focused enough, attentive enough, or bright enough to recognize it.

I definately IS a problem, but not one that most cleaners notice and not one that most mfgs want to try to solve. Greenie was the only guy who agreed that it was a valid occurance and attempted to solve it.

I used to think it was caused by the additional height of the jets, caused by the adding of the glide, but putting extenders on the jets, or changing the width of the spray pattern didn't affect it. Since Lisa started making flat bottomed glides with a side slot, I wonder if that didn't stop it, but I have long since stopped using the Greenhorn and so I can't tell.

I do know that my current wand with a flat bottomed glide on it doesn't overspray much.
